COVENTRY City Council has been urged to help more disabled residents into work and support employers in making the lives of those in employment easier.

- By DAVID LAWRENCE

Appeal to help more disabled residents into work

The idea was put forward by Labour's Cllr Kevin Maton during the latest finance and corporate services strategy board meeting.

Cllr Richard Brown, the cabinet member for strategic finance and resources, told the meeting that for the first time in more than a decade there might be cash available after funding had been allocated to all the council's essential services.

There will be a vote on the council's budget for the coming 12 months at a full council meeting.

He said: “The budget that comes before you will not be proposing any service cuts and there may be some financial headroom. During consultation we are asking, if there is some financial headroom, where is this best applied.
